FORMATION OF ENVIRONMENT DIRECTORATE IN 
RAILWAY BOARD 
• 
Environment & Kousekeeping Management (EnHM) Dte 
set up vide Rly Bd’s O.O. No 28 of 15 and O.O. No. 30 of 
2015 dtd 08.04.15  
• 
Headed by Advisor directly under CRB 
• 
EDs from Civil Engg, Electrical Engg, Mechanical, Traffic 
& Commercial, Finance and Efficiency & Research 
directorates to be part of this dte 
• 
Monitor performance of ZRs & PUs on: (a) Pollution 
control (b) Efficiency in consumption of energy (c) 
Conservation of resources, particularly water (d) 
Development, production & use of alternative sources 
of energy 
(Ref: Rly Bd L/No 2015/Environ/6/1 dtd 07.01.15)

REPORTING OF ENVIRONMENT ISSUES TO 
ENVIRONMENT DIRECTORATE 
•  GMs & CAOs were advised to arrange period 
compilation on environment issues/actions 
•  By Planning & Efficiency wing on Zonal 
Railways to be coordinated by SDGM/AGM 
•  By M&P maintenance wing in PUs 
(Ref: Rly Bd L/No 2015/Environ/6/1 dtd 07.01.15)

REPORTING OF ENVIRONMENT ISSUES TO 
ENVIRONMENT DIRECTORATE 
Actions requested on (i) Monitoring trend of Consumption of 
Traction Energy (Electricity & Diesel) (ii) Audit & 
Accreditation on Environment in Major Work Centers viz 
workshops, depots/sheds & railway stations (iii) 
Undertaking Audits on Energy & Water consumption in ‘A’ 
category consumption centres (iv) Introducing a system of 
user level (including stations) monitoring of consumption of 
all types of energy as well as water on monthly basis (v) 
Identification of ongoing works having positive contribution 
towards Environment (vi) Annexing a report in MCDO on 
trends/development on above environmental issues 
departmentwise 
(Ref: Rly Bd L/No 2015/Environ/6/1 dtd 07.01.15)

FORMATION OF ENHM WING IN ZR 
•  Scope limited to 16 ZRs excluding Metro Rly, Kolkata 
•  ENHM organization to function as a separate and 
exclusive Wing under the control of GM & CME in ZRs 
and under DRM & SrDME in Division 
•  No new Gazetted posts to be created for EnHM Wing 
•  Posts from departments undertaking Housekeeping 
activities like Mechanized cleaning of A1 & A category 
stations, coaches, pest & rodent control, OBHS and linen 
managements and petty repairs to be identified, 
aggregated and transferred to EnHM Wing 
•  JAG in HQ and SS officer in Division exclusively with 
executive officers below as required 
•  Gaztted posts of EnHM wing may be manned by officers 
from Mechanical, Traffic/commercial, Engineering & 
Electrical branches 
(Ref: Rly Bd L/No 2015/EnHM/06/02 dtd 28.08.15)

FORMATION OF ENHM WING IN ZR 
•  Supervisors of all departments hitherto engaged in 
above activities to be deputed to work exclusively in 
EnHM wing 
•  Management of Housekeeping activities, wherever 
outsourced, to be managed by EnHM wing; but 
wherever being done departmentally to continue as 
such and transferred to EnHM wing whenever 
decided for outsourcing 
•  In-charge supervisors of Engg/Mechanical/
Electrical/Traffic & Commercial departments 
responsible for management of stations & depots to 
continue inspectorial roles in housekeeping activities 
besides supervisors of EnHM wing 
 
(Ref: Rly Bd L/No 2015/EnHM/06/02 dtd 28.08.15)
